Jimmy Eat World Summer 2014 Tour, See U.S. Dates
Popular pop/rock band, Jimmy Eat World, have announced a short run of U.S. tour dates that run through the end of May. The dates kick off on May 16th in Houston, TX at the House of Blues and end on May 25th in Reno, NV at Cargo. See full dates below. Stagnant Pools will be joining the May tour as the opening act.

Jimmy Eat World formed in 1993 in Mesa, Arizona. They have released eight full length albums including their breakout albums Clarity (1999) and Bleed American (2001) which included their smash hit, "The Middle" which went to No. 1 on modern rock charts. Their next album Futures (2004) featured another Modern Rock Tracks number one song, "Pain".The RIAA certified Bleed American platinum and Futures gold, rewarding the two albums for selling over one and a half million records between them. The band's sixth album Chase This Light (2007) became the band's highest charting album, peaking at number five on the Billboard 200. Jimmy Eat World is lead vocalist and guitarist Jim Adkins, guitarist and backing vocalist Tom Linton, bassist Rick Burch and drummer Zach Lind.
